GOVERNMENT OF INDIA MINISTRY OF COMMUNICATIONS DEPARTMENT OF TELECOMMUNICATIONS LOK SABHA STARRED QUESTION NO. 535 TO BE ANSWERED ON 01ST APRIL, 2026 QUALITY OF TELECOM SERVICES IN YSR KADAPA DISTRICT, ANDHRA PRADESH *535. SHRI Y S AVINASH REDDY: Will the Minister of COMMUNICATIONS be pleased to state: (a) the details of the Quality of Service (QoS) results for YSR Kadapa District, Andhra Pradesh from the latest TRAI Independent Drive Tests (IDT), including number of mobile towers, call drop rate, call set-up time and 4G/5G data speed; (b) whether any issues of right-of-way, power back-up, or fibre cuts in YSR Kadapa district have been raised with the State Government or local bodies and if so, the details thereof; (c) the number of compliance reports received from telecom operators following the October 2025 IDT in Andhra Pradesh; and (d) whether any penalties or show-cause notices have been issued for repeated service quality failures and if so, the details thereof? ANSWER MINISTER OF COMMUNICATIONS AND DEVELOPMENT OF NORTH EASTERN REGION (SHRI JYOTIRADITYA M. SCINDIA) (a) to (d) A statement is laid on the Table of the House. 1STATEMENT REFERRED TO IN REPLY TO PARTS (a) TO (d) OF LOK SABHA STARRED QUESTION NO. 535 ANSWERED ON 01.04.2026 ASKED BY SHRI Y S AVINASH REDDY, HON’BLE MEMBER OF PARLIAMENT REGARDING ‘QUALITY OF TELECOM SERVICES IN YSR KADAPA DISTRICT, ANDHRA PRADESH’ (a) The Telecom Regulatory Authority of India (TRAI) has laid down QoS benchmarks for Telecom Service Providers (TSPs) and has required that they indicate in their tariff offerings for broadband(wireless) service that typical download and upload speed generally available to consumers. Recently, it has revised these benchmarks to make them more stringent and lay down the glide path for their further enhancement. It also publishes a monthly report on the performance reported by TSPs against various QoS parameters as well as the typical upload and download speed indicated by TSPs in their tariff offerings. TRAI conducted an Independent Drive Test (IDT) in YSR Kadapa District, Andhra Pradesh during the period from 17.2.2026 to 19.2.2026. (c) An IDT was conducted by TRAI in the State of Andhra Pradesh during the month of October 2025 and the observations during IDT were communicated to TSPs for action. As per the compliance reports submitted by TSPs to TRAI, 128 sites were optimised, and 2 new sites installed to improve network coverage. (d) TRAI monitors the performance of TSPs against its QoS benchmarks and publishes monthly reports of performance of each TSP in each license service area (LSA). If any benchmark is not met, TRAI calls for explanation from the TSP concerned, and after considering the response, if TRAI finds that benchmarks have not been complied with, it imposes financial disincentives for the same on the TSP. As per the reports for the months of January and February 2026, all service providers met the benchmarks for all network-related QoS parameters for access service (wireless) in all license service area (LSAs), including the Andhra Pradesh license service area. ***** 3
